Marks Tey is equipped with a variety of facilities to enhance your travel experience. The ticket office operates with extensive hours, open from 5:35 AM to 10:10 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 8:20 AM to 7:30 PM on Sundays. Ticket machines are readily accessible, enabling you to collect pre-purchased tickets with ease.
For those requiring assistance, staff are available daily, ready to help you with any queries or requirements. While luggage storage isn’t available, you will find accessibility measures such as step-free access to all platforms albeit with a longer transfer time between them due to the station layout. Marks Tey also caters to cyclists, offering 260 bike parking spaces and secured compounds to ensure your bikes are safe while you travel.
The station is accommodating to travelers with accessibility needs, providing wheelchair availability, an induction loop, and accessible toilets. Whether you're grabbing a quick refreshment from Coffeelink or utilizing the free Wi-Fi provided, Marks Tey ensures that your needs are met while waiting for your train.

Despite its unassuming nature, Heworth Station provides some basic amenities. There is no manned ticket office, but passengers can easily buy and collect pre-purchased tickets using the available ticket machines, which are fully accessible. The station is categorized as a Category B Station, meaning that while it is unstaffed, it has ramped access to platforms, ensuring wheelchair users and those with mobility impairments can navigate without issues. However, do note that facilities like toilets, waiting rooms, refreshment services, and bicycle storage are lacking, perhaps making it more of a transit point than a hangout location.
Though CCTV is not present, there are customer help points scattered throughout the station to ensure assistance is just a call away, offering a sense of security and support to travelers. For those seeking additional help, the conductor on the arriving train is available to assist with boarding and disembarking needs.
